NITORI Group, founded in 1967, is a Japanese furniture and home accessories retailer and the largest furniture chain in Japan, with over 840 stores worldwide.
Its mission is “to provide the foundation of prosperous home living to the global community,” which guides all company activities and reflects its focus on enhancing quality of life through practical home solutions. This mission is shared by all employees and forms the basis of its corporate culture.
Overall, NITORI aims to deliver comfort, value, and better living standards to customers worldwide through its mission-driven approach and continuous improvement.
